Nailers sign rookie defenseman Carter

WHEELING, W.Va. - The Wheeling Nailers, ECHL affiliate of the Pittsburgh Penguins, announced the team has signed defenseman Dalton Carter to a contract for the 2018-19 season.

Carter, 24, got his first taste of professional hockey by appearing in a pair of ECHL games in the spring, but enters the 2018-19 campaign as a rookie. He attended Utica College for four years, and is coming off of his best collegiate season, as he finished second on the team in scoring, racking up 39 points (11g-28a) in 26 games. Carter was Utica College's top defensive scorer in two of his four years at the school, completing his career as a Pioneer with 82 points in 106 contests.

The Sylvania, Ohio native had a chance to make his pro debut close to home, as he suited up with the Toledo Walleye in a pair of contests after completing his collegiate career.
